Installation Celebration of Rev. Michael R. Lomax

Published: June 4, 2010

Pleasant Green Baptist Church, 1410 Jefferson St., installed Rev. Michael R. Lomax, pastor, on Sunday, March 14, following a glorious weekend of installation activities. A Pancake Breakfast and First Lady's Luncheon honoring Mrs. Tamura Lomax on Saturday preceded Sunday's celebration.

Drs. Forest Harris and William Buchanan participated in the installation service, as well as other local and out–of–state ministers and musical guests. The pastor and first lady's family and friends from across the country were in attendance...See More

An Evening of 100 Hats

Published: April 10, 2010

An evening of 100 hats was hosted by the Women’s Day Department of Bethesda Original Church of God. “If you are a lover of hats,” said Judy Shelton, the event coordinator, “You missed something special.” Following the devotion, Sis. Beverly Shelton, Mistress of Ceremony, led the women in their show of hats through Fall/Winter and Spring/Summer. There were also several booths that brought another dimension to the afternoon.
